Book Summary
Ranks of the Elite is an academic study that makes a presentation of the virtues, works, and features of great scholars, saints, and other influential figures within the Islamic period.
Imam Ibn Jawzi has compiled this book for enlightenment of the reader through examples of excellence and piety. This book can be subdivided into sections dealing with various figures and their contributions to the Islamic tradition.

Book Structure
The structure of Ranks of the Elite is methodical, making it easy for the readers to understand the various sections clearly.
Each chapter starts with a short introduction to the figure under discussion, after which comes the chronological account of their life, teachings, and their impact on the Muslim community.
This enhances the readability of the book, giving it a liberal atmosphere for readers of all ages.
